Actually they're pretty much correct. Unless you are restricting visitors from viewing any threads (which would be better done with usergroups), bots should be just fine, provided that they don't read and send cookies. If you're using IP blocking, that steps up the risk a bit and relies on filters, but so long as those cover the bot in question, the same is true.
Ultimately anyone can still view any thread. What matters is how the visiting machine responds to repeat requests and that's true whether you set things to 1 or 100,000.
